Bank of China (Hong Kong) (HKG:2388) launched four new fixed-interest-rate mortgage plans with interest rates between 3.15% and 3.35% for two to five years, offering more choices to borrowers, The Standard reported Friday.
The customers can lock in an interest rate for their mortgages for some time under the new plans. Experts believe that the move will help property sales, according to the report.
